SENATE BILL NO. 69
BY SENATORS CARTER AND THOMPSON 
Prefiled pursuant to Article III, Section 2(A)(4)(b)(i) of the Constitution of Louisiana.
1	AN ACT
2 To enact R.S. 2:2, relative to unmanned aircraft; to provide for definitions; to provide
3 exclusive jurisdiction to the state in the regulation of such systems; to preempt local
4 ordinances, rules, regulations, and codes; to provide for federal preemption; and to
5 provide for related matters.
6 Be it enacted by the Legislature of Louisiana:
7 Section 1.  R.S. 2:2 is hereby enacted to read as follows:
8 ยง2. Regulation of unmanned aerial systems and unmanned aircraft systems;
9	preemption
10	A.  Subject to the provisions of Subsection C of this Section and except
11 as otherwise provided by law:
12	(1)  The state shall have exclusive jurisdiction to regulate all unmanned
13 aircraft systems and all unmanned aerial systems.
14	(2) State law shall supersede and preempt any rule, regulation, code, or
15 ordinance of any political subdivision or other unit of local government.
16	B.  As used in this Section, the following phrases shall have the following
17 meanings:
18	(1) "Unmanned aerial system" means an unmanned aircraft and all
19 associated support equipment, control station, data links, telemetry,
20 communications, and navigation equipment necessary to operate the unmanned
21 aircraft. The system may include drones, remote-controlled aircraft, unmanned
22 aircraft, or any other such aircraft that is controlled autonomously by computer
23 or remote control from the ground.
24	(2) "Unmanned aircraft system" means an unmanned, powered aircraft

1 that does not carry a human operator, may be autonomous or remotely piloted
2 or operated, and may be expendable or recoverable. "Unmanned aircraft
3 system" does not include any of the following:
4	(a) A satellite orbiting the earth.
5	(b) An unmanned aircraft system used by the federal government or a
6 person who is acting pursuant to contract with the federal government to
7 conduct surveillance of specific activities.
8	(c) An unmanned aircraft system used by the state government or a
9 person who is acting pursuant to a contract with the state government to
10 conduct surveillance of specific activities.
11	(d) An unmanned aircraft system used by a local government law
12 enforcement agency or fire department.
13	(e) An unmanned aircraft system used by a person, affiliate, employee,
14 agent, or contractor of any business that is regulated by the Louisiana Public
15 Service Commission, while acting in the course and scope of his employment or
16 agency relating to the operation, repair, or maintenance of a facility, servitude,
17 or any property located on the immovable property belonging to such business.
18	(f) An unmanned aircraft system used by a person, affiliate, employee,
19 agent, or contractor of any business that is regulated by a local franchising
20 authority, while acting in the course and scope of his employment or agency
21 relating to the operation, repair, or maintenance of a facility, servitude, or any
22 property located on the immovable property belonging to such business.
23	(g) An unmanned aircraft system used by a person, affiliate, employee,
24 agent, or contractor of any business that is regulated by the Federal
25 Communications Commission under the Cable Television Consumer Protection
26 and Competition Act of 1992 or under Part 73 of Title 47 of the United States
27 Code of Federal Regulations, while acting in the course and scope of his
28 employment or agency relating to the operation, repair, or maintenance of a
29 facility, servitude, or any property located on the immovable property
30 belonging to such business.

1	(h) An unmanned aircraft system used by a person, affiliate, employee,
2 agent, or contractor of a municipal or public utility while acting in the course
3 and scope of his employment or agency relating to the operation, repair, or
4 maintenance of a facility, servitude, or any property located on the immovable
5 property belonging to such municipal or public utility.
6	(i)  An unmanned aircraft system used by a person, affiliate, employee,
7 agent, or contractor of any business that is regulated by the Federal Railroad
8 Administration, while acting in the course and scope of his employment or
9 agency relating to the operation, repair, or maintenance of a facility, equipment,
10 servitude, or any property located on the immovable property belonging to such
11 business.
12	C.  If federal law or regulation preempts any provision of this Section,
13 that provision of this Section shall be null.
14 Section 2.  This Act shall become effective upon signature by the governor or, if not
15 signed by the governor, upon expiration of the time for bills to become law without signature
16 by the governor, as provided by Article III, Section 18 of the Constitution of Louisiana. If
17 vetoed by the governor and subsequently approved by the legislature, this Act shall become
18 effective on the day following such approval.
